Why the correction matters
Liquid changes density with temperature, so a warm sample sits lighter and reads low, while a cold one reads high. Straight off the kettle a reading can be off by several gravity points, which then throws off your OG, your efficiency, and your final ABV.
The fix is either to cool the sample to the calibration temperature before reading, or to read it as-is and correct it here. Both get you to the same true gravity.
Finding your calibration temperature
It is printed on the hydrometer or its paperwork, usually 68F (20C), sometimes 60F (15.6C). Enter the value your hydrometer states so the correction is accurate.
The further your sample is from that temperature, the bigger the correction. Near the calibration point it is tiny; a sample at 100F against a 68F hydrometer shifts by roughly 0.005.
